Output 3b41c8534a01847b0d79cad6bf3cddb45bd19aa2d8218d02d29494bfc83ad88c:31

value
2614785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8dd6b70def99dcba116c38b68f53d0f8ad43e7 OP_EQUAL
address
3MtVB4nU8pwynKDX84vyPGaELRG9eKzpmu
transaction
3b41c8534a01847b0d79cad6bf3cddb45bd19aa2d8218d02d29494bfc83ad88c
spent
true